About

Seokchan Hong is a scholar working on Rheumatology, Nephrology and Surgery. According to data from OpenAlex, Seokchan Hong has authored 154 papers receiving a total of 1.8k indexed citations (citations by other indexed papers that have themselves been cited), including 85 papers in Rheumatology, 27 papers in Nephrology and 24 papers in Surgery. Recurrent topics in Seokchan Hong's work include Systemic Lupus Erythematosus Research (39 papers), Rheumatoid Arthritis Research and Therapies (25 papers) and Spondyloarthritis Studies and Treatments (14 papers). Seokchan Hong is often cited by papers focused on Systemic Lupus Erythematosus Research (39 papers), Rheumatoid Arthritis Research and Therapies (25 papers) and Spondyloarthritis Studies and Treatments (14 papers). Seokchan Hong collaborates with scholars based in South Korea, United States and Australia. Seokchan Hong's co-authors include Yong‐Gil Kim, Chang‐Keun Lee, Bin Yoo, Ji Seon Oh, Jae Hoon Cho, Jin Kook Kim, Oh Chan Kwon, Soo Min Ahn, Jung Sun Lee and Byeongzu Ghang and has published in prestigious journals such as SHILAP Revista de lepidopterología, The Journal of Immunology and PLoS ONE.
